The form asks you for the passport number and country of issue for every passport you have ever owned. I have had three passports in my lifeand had recorded the passport numbers. If you have recorded your previously issued passport numbers that's all you need. Otherwise you have no choice other than to make a request for information, with associated fee, from your local passport office.
